According to a recent study,there are about 70,000 blind children in Indonesia.Among them,60 percent were not born blind.Iyehezkiel Parudani is one of them,who lost his eyesight by accident at age six.He now teaches English to blind students at the Pajajaran Special SchooL Iyehezkiel Parudani says learning English can help blind people feel better about themselves."By learning English,they can be an English teacher,a translator,and a tour guide."Students read using Braille (盲文).To write,they use special tools,too.

Iyehezkiel Parudani says blind people should not let their physical disability influence their dreams.In 2008,he got a chance to study at the University of Texas.Two years later,he got a master's degree in course development there.

"In the US,if I go to the university to study,everything is available﹣like e﹣books,Braille books.Here in Indonesia,you know,it's difficult to find a reference book in e﹣book or in Braille.We have to make it ourselves.In the US,I can move wherever I want because everything designed is really accessible for people with blindness."

Eha Lestari,one of his star students,says learning English has changed her life.She has already traveled to the US with the help of an Indonesia﹣U.S.program."I study English because I love English very much.I want to be a translator because I want to go to the other countries and then I want to meet some people from around the world."

Like her classmates,Eha loves to sing.Here,music is part of daily life.Even the students who do not study English can sing some American pop songs,such as Stand By Me,"Stand by me.Please stand,stand by me.Stand by me…"

Iyehezkiel Parudani says the song has special meaning to the students."In our life,we need other persons.You have to stand by me.Without you standing by me,I'm meaningless."

A new camera made by a company named Netatmo has facial recognition software (识别系统) that can tell parents at work that their children have returned from school,or that a package has been taken to their home.It can also tell them if a stranger has entered their home.

Janina Mattausch is a product marketing manager for Netatmo.

"The common security (安全) cameras at present are not that smart.So,they can tell you if something is moving but they don't necessarily know if it's a human being or,ah,if it's your kids﹣﹣they don't know the difference,so they will warn you all the time."

When family members enter a home,the new camera"recognizes"(识别 ) them and sends information to the owner's smartphone.The owner can choose to see the video then or later.But if an unknown person enters a home,the camera will send the owner a warning that will cause an alarm to sound on the owner's smartphone.

That is what happened recently to a smart home camera owner named Darrmen.He lives in Paris.

"On a Friday I was at work,atending a big monthly meeting when my phone warned.At first I told myself'Oh,it must be a mistake,maybe I have to set the system again.'﹣but the notice on my phone was telling me that there was a movement in my flat and also a face that the software did not recognize."

He watched the video and was very surprised by what he saw.

"I saw a person I did not know with his shoes on.I was watching it live on video.So I felt totaly unbelievable,frozen.I asked a workmate to take me back home as fast as possible and I called the police on the way."

With the help of the video,the police found the intruder (闯入者) later that day.

CBC Canada,CTV News

A group of Canadian kids are spreading a bit of Christmas spirit in Halifax,Nova Scotia,by covering warm clothes around light poles (灯杆) for the city's homeless people to pick up and use.It was such an unusual sight that locals stopped to take pictures to share on social media (媒体).

Every year,Tara Atkins﹣Smith collects warm clothes from her community in order to help the less lucky.This year,since the family was traveling to Halifax with their daughter Jayda and seven of her friends to celebrate her 8th birthday Tara thought it was the perfect time to teach the chidren a valuable life lesson.

The kids spent time handing out coats to the homeless and tied the rest around light poles for others to pick up.Each of the clothes had a tag that read,"I am not lost.If you are caught in the cold,please take me to keep warm."According to Tara,the experience helped the children better understand the difficult situation of homeless people,who have to brave the cold winter on the streets."When we got back in the car after an hour on the street,they were all freezing cold and crying for the heater (火炉) to be on because they were cold,"she said.

By next morning,all the jackets,gloves,and scarves on the poles were gone.Photos of the inspriring project have been shared about 8,000times on Facebook,and have got over10,000likes.Tara,who did something similar in Toronto in December last year,says she's already planning next year's coat drive.She hopes that the meaningful thing can spread around the world,and she also wants to add 5 fast food gift card so that the homeless people can also enjoy a hot meal.

"We've got help from others when we were in need,and we knew how great it made us feel,"said Zackary Atkins,Tara's husband.
